[QUOTE="chscag, post: 1306899, member: 46727"] Actually, what you did with MacDrive is a manual sync. Why not try going the other way? In other words, instead of reading the Mac library from the PC side, read the PC library from the Mac side. Paragon Software sells Paragon NTFS for $19.95 which is a lot less expensive than the $49.95 cost of MacDrive.
